Value Vs. Price for a Floor Installation

When you’re hiring a flooring contractor, it’s a difficult thing to find the perfect balance between pricing and value. Remember that when you hire the cheapest contractor, you may end up having to spend more in the long haul because they do a poor job and use lower quality materials. Hiring the cheapest of contractors should be avoided unless you want to risk having to hire for the same job more than once. There are plenty of online resources for researching on the relative quality and prices of different flooring materials.

When you and the contractor are talking about the pricing points, take note of prices that don’t seem realistic. Many contractors don’t survive very long, which can be a real problem for anyone relying on them to honor a warranty. Ask yourself what you will do if you need to make a claim against a warranty from a flooring contractor who’s closed up shop and disappeared. Have the warranty info in writing before proceeding with the negotiation.

Local References

Requesting three local area contacts from your local contractor is a smart move. Work only with a licensed contractor whose references are unassailable. When determining whether or not to hire a particular flooring contractor, make sure to contact the references provided so that you could find out how their crew treats properties. When the flooring job is complete, the crew must clean up the mess. Verify this with the reference. Also ask if their home was returned to its original condition when the job was completed. After all, you want to make sure the local contractor you choose will take care of your property and belongings.

A Professional Flooring Contractor

Liability insurance on behalf of the local contractor should be ensured before you employ. If an insurance company considers the local contractor an acceptable risk, you know the business is legitimate and reputable. After all, you never want to get caught working with a local contractor that’s not insured. People who are insured are contractors who pay attention to detail.

Ensuring that a licensed contractor has professional signage on his vehicle is definitely an important detail to take note of. Car rental establishments offer most anyone the ability to rent a car or truck, even those fraudulent drivers pretending to be contractors. Pay attention to whether the call number is long distance or local. Calling the number on the sign should help ensure the validity of the number.

It’s A Messy Job!

It’s important you ask about how potential mess will be prevented by the flooring contractor. The very best flooring contractors know to use heavy plastic barriers to protect the home and property. Most contractors like to produce a barrier for both paint and dust, by utilizing a special overlap procedure. Wrapping the room with red tape that reads, “Men Working. ” is also something that they do, similar to a crime scene that you have seen in the movies.

Unfinished flooring areas should have heavy plastic draping to prevent children from entering the room. Ask if the draping is covered in the quoted price. Youngsters who’re unsupervised are more likely to step on nails during a project. Potential injuries can be foreseen and prevented by professional flooring contractors. You want to ensure that the service provider does not create a horrible and unsafe atmosphere for your kids.
